Global rail technology leader to join Expedia's family of top
global brands
BELLEVUE, Washington and LONDON, May 11,
2017 /PRNewswire/ -- Expedia, Inc., (NASDAQ: EXPE) and
SilverRail Technologies, Inc., today announced entry into a
definitive agreement in which Expedia® will acquire a majority
stake in SilverRail. SilverRail set out to solve rail's most
challenging technology problems and has been an important Expedia
industry partner, helping to bring online booking for rail to
Expedia's customers.

SilverRail will remain focused on transforming the consumer
experience of rail for carriers, travel retailers, and corporate
travel companies. The transaction is anticipated to close in the
middle of 2017 pending satisfaction of closing conditions,
including approval from the relevant competition authority.

About SilverRail
SilverRail are powering global rail with its next generation
retailing and distribution platform.
SilverRail's technology is purpose built for rail. Our product
suite spans the full customer experience: journey planning,
inventory management, scheduling, pricing, booking, payment,
ticketing, reporting and administration.
SilverCore is the world's first unified platform for global rail
distribution, it connects carriers and suppliers to both online and
offline travel distributors.
- SilverRail handles more than 1 billion online rail searches
each year.
- SilverRail distributes tickets for more than 35 providers and
carriers
- SilverRail processes more than 25 million bookings each
year.
- SilverRail serves more than 1,500 corporate customers
worldwide.
SilverRail was founded in 2009 by Aaron
Gowell and Will Phillipson,
is headquartered in London, and
has offices in Boston,
Stockholm and Brisbane.
